The third episode of Fireside Chatbots, a miniseries within our Intelligent Future series on artificial intelligence. This week, Reid Hoffman poses questions to OpenAI's ChatGPT about the potential impact of AI in educational settings.

Of the many transformative possibilities of artificial intelligence, its potential to impact education is among the most exciting. It’s also one of the most contentious. While it could extend the reach of over-worked teachers, offer personalized curriculums, and enhance the learning experience, it could also present many drawbacks: cheating, loss of jobs, and a reliance on technology that impedes the development of critical-thinking skills.
